静态站点的评论系统虽然很多,但综合考虑能够真正用起来并且很稳定的很少。 以前的多说没了,Disqus虽然很强大,但毕竟是第三方,也免不了可能出现多说的情况。所以,我的站点最后选用了 gitalk ,站点就在 git 上,用 git 提供的功能应该能稳定点。
网上虽然有很多关于 gitalk 的文章,不过可能他们进行的太过顺利,于是很多细节没有写出来,所以参考那些文章会遇到大把大把的问题。 这次通过自己安装评论系统,把经验写出来,希望其他人不要遇到同样的坑。
前两篇博文基本能解决搭建和使用问题,而且功能也够用了。不过有几个问题还是需要解决, 一个是样式问题,能不能统一提取样式作为皮肤,想修改的时候修改个配置所有的地方都能一起变动。 还有一个问题是代码高亮问题。
那咱们继续。
npm install --save gatsby-plugin-alias-imports
再修改 gatsby-config.js
的 plugins
部分。
记得小时候在县城上学,学校每次放月假,爷爷就去车站接我回家。
那时家里离车站上远,需要骑着车子来回。
上一篇做了导航菜单、弄出了博文列表、博文预览及翻页器。
基本的功能弄的差不多了,不过还需要用这些基本功能再完善一下博客。
首页也需要改改、返回顶部的按钮、还有本人比较喜欢的滚动条进度条、统计、Google被搜索等等。
博客首页的传统实现方式是显示部分博文,下方再加个 Read More 的按钮。
只有一种首页是不是太单调了,在特殊节日我想搞个特效页面什么的展示在首页。 所以,我弄了个配置,如果是普通日子,就默认用传统的有分页,博文部分显示的首页。 如果是特殊节日,根据开发的特效页面不同,也能很快的进行切换。